1,333 students
BISMARCK HIGH SCHOOL reports 1,333 students, larger than most same-level county peers. Among 5 other high schools in Burleigh County with enrollment data, 3 report fewer students and 2 report more. The peer median is 94 students.
6 high schools
The same-level county median enrollment is 714 students. Use it to separate unusually small or large schools from typical peers.
29 district schools
BISMARCK 1 lists 19 primary, 4 middle, 5 high, 1 other schools in the current NCES data. For a high-school choice, compare graduation context, program access, commute, and nearby alternatives before using one enrollment number as the deciding signal.
